I just aquired a new PC and I'm trying to generate a SOPC design which was previously generated on another PC. However, when I open the SOPC design on the new PC, there is a error message present : Error: <altmemddr>: The given combination of PLL input and output cannot be synthesized. I tried changing the input/output combination, but that did'nt help. I find this strange, since the QII versions are exactly the same on both PC's (version 11.1sp2). Even when I try adding a new instance of the DDR2 SDRAM controller with ALTMEMPHY the error message is present. Can anyone provide some help out with this issue ?Link Copied

I'm not sure but I think I might have installed the sp2 before the sp1,
however, I re-installed Quartus II (11.1 -> 11.1sp1 -> 11.1sp2) and that helped.
